Join us for a day of thought-provoking discussions and cutting-edge insights at the 2nd Annual UCSF Hillblom Brain Aging Center Symposium. This year’s theme, From Mechanisms to Meaning: Pathways to Resilient Brain Aging, highlights the latest advancements in brain health and aging research.

The symposium will feature presentations from leading experts, engaging panel discussions, and opportunities to connect with colleagues. Lunch will be provided at 12:35 p.m.
